    KitchenAid is another iconic American brand we all grew up with and still love today! Owned by Whirlpool Corporation, KitchenAid was started in 1919 to produce stand mixers. My sweet Momma gifted me her KitchenAid mixer and we use it to this day! It is durable, reliable, and pretty! It is amazing the volume of attachments that are available for purchase for this KitchenAid mixer that can turn that machine into a pasta maker, a pasta cutter, aa grain mill, a shaved ice maker, a food processer, a sausage stuffer, a sifter/food scale, a food grinder, and a food slicker/shredder. This KitchenAid mixer is a powerhouse and can do much much more than what we use it for which is primarily cake and brownie mixes and homemade bread making. I agree with Yelp friend, Marianne, I do love the KitchenAid blender colors! Their colors range from "scorched orange" to "matcha" to "cast iron black." KitchenAid also makes and markets espresso machines, coffee makers, and coffee grinders, kettles, toasters, food processors, hand mixers, countertop ovens, grain and rice cookers and cookware. KitchenAid's major appliances include refrigerators, ranges, dishwashers, microwaves, ovens, disposals/compactors, and hoods/vents. Thanks, KitchenAid, for years of enjoyment from your iconic KitchenAid mixer!

    A few years ago, I ordered a KitchenAid 5 burner downdraft cooktop (which retails at around $2,400). There are only a few companies that sell this type of cooktop, another is JennAir, both of which are owned by Whirlpool. The JennAir was out of stock. So, I purchased the KitchenAid which works fine, but the knob bezels are a joke. They were replaced once under my extended warranty, but now they look and work the same as the originals which I replaced. They are loose because the glue failed and the paint has chipped away, so they look terrible. I reached out to Whirlpool customer service, and they told me that the bezels aren't covered. My takeaway from the email exchange was that they didn't really care if I was a happy customer, or not. It's not covered - next!! I can order replacements from Manny's Appliance, where I purchased the cooktop, at a cost of ONLY $36 EACH (I'd need to buy 6 of these). Yup, they are sold individually! I guess Whirlpool thinks this is a fair price for a cheap, plastic, painted bezel that's likely to look like this after 6-12 months. Why couldn't they use stainless steel? I assume it was a cost cutting issue, though I can't image it could save much. Buyer beware!
